  • Download PNG Loyola Ramblers Logo PNG The logo of the athletic teams representing Loyola University Chicago features LU Wolf, the university’s mascot.
  • Meaning and history 1999 – 2011 On both the old Loyola Ramblers logo and current one, you can see only the wolf’s muzzle.
  • 2012 – Today In 2012, the Ramblers updated their emblem.
  • The head moved to the top, while the lettering on the Loyola Ramblers logo grew larger and more prominent.

  • Loyola Ramblers Colors MAROON PANTONE: PMS 208 C HEX COLOR: #922247; RGB: (146, 34, 71) CMYK: (11, 94, 35, 31) GOLD PANTONE: PMS 123 C HEX COLOR: #FEBD18; RGB: (254, 189, 24) CMYK: (0, 28, 98, 24)
